English: Zlín, Czech Republic, Osvoboditelů street 18, former villa of Jan Antonín Bata, now the seat of the Czech Radio, studios Zlín. Early modernist building from the years 1926-1927, designed by František Lydie Gahura, built by Zlamal and Placek.
